I think he was referring to the fact that you use wildcards in your *fix
requests for the Husky tools (ie: [+]*/-* to subscribe to all echos
available, rather than D'Bridge and SBBSecho using [+]ALL/-ALL). Both ways
probably match other software, but since Mark was used to DB and possibly
SBBSecho, it was a different scenario for him specifically.
